A Poem by FlatLineBeauty

The tears still flow freely down my cheeks
I often wonder how it came to this
The feeling of excitement welling up inside me
Anytime I saw your name
I used to love the way you made me feel
For once I had felt loved
I could have sworn that I was almost alive
A feeling of dread quickly flooded over me
This time I pushed too far
Pushed you away into the arms of someone else
I hate thinking about it
Wondering if you tell her the same things you once told me
Do you kiss her the way you kissed me?
Everything has turned upside down
Seeing you only brings pain
I still love you
Care has never left
It's like you ripped out my heart 
Turning it to dust
Why does this have to be so painful?
I hope you are happy
That she treats you right
I will sit here by my pile of ashes
Shifting the dust of what is left in my hands
Nothing will ever be the same again
An emotional emptiness fills my whole body
The pain is more than I can bare
